单次使用的加密或安全实践

时间:2013-06-09 23:06:06

标签: encryption

我想加密文件并分享。我想将文件解密一次。我想知道是否有可用于实现一次性使用场景的安全或加密协议。简单来说,解密密钥只有一次是好的。

1 个答案:

答案 0 :(得分:3)

不,不可能,任何类型的计算机和任何类型的操作系统。

您想要的是DRM,并且您的文件需要由您编码的程序读取,该程序在读取后会破坏文件(和解码密钥)。但是为了保护decyphering程序不被复制,您必须针对您的操作系统签署应用程序,并使您的操作系统保护该文件不被删除。并且为了保护您的操作系统不被文件复制,您必须使用CPU中具有芯片的计算机,使一切都无法使用......这就是所谓的可信计算。

虽然它理论上可行,但仍然可以保留文件的副本,并使用超级计算机长达1000年(或一小时,具体取决于您的算法和密钥的大小)找到你的解密密钥,从而获取你宝贵的内容。

对于这个故事,索尼已经尝试将DRM放入他们的CD中,that's what they end up creating